Understanding the Whipple Procedure

The Whipple procedure is a major abdominal operation performed for selected diseases involving the head of the pancreas and nearby structures. It is one of the more complex surgeries in general surgical practice.

Depending on the individual case, the operation may involve removal of:

  • The head of the pancreas
  • The duodenum (the first part of the small intestine)
  • The gallbladder
  • Part of the bile duct
  • Sometimes part of the stomach

After removal of these structures, the remaining digestive organs are surgically reconnected to restore the continuity of the digestive tract. This reconnection is what makes the procedure technically demanding and why postoperative recovery requires careful monitoring over an extended period.

Clinical Explanation

The pancreas serves two main functions. It produces enzymes that help digest food, and it produces hormones like insulin that regulate blood sugar. When a portion of the pancreas is removed, both functions can be affected. This is why patients after Whipple surgery often need support with digestion and blood glucose management during recovery. The extent of functional change varies from person to person and cannot always be predicted before surgery.

Why Home Healthcare Was Needed

The decision to arrange home healthcare was based on several clinical and practical considerations. A Whipple procedure is not a surgery from which patients quickly return to normal life. Even after a stable hospital discharge, significant recovery challenges remain.

Clinical Reasons for Home Care

At the time of discharge, Harleen had the following ongoing needs:

  • Reduced stamina: She became tired after short periods of activity. She could not yet manage household tasks or walk reasonable distances without support.
  • Abdominal wound: Her surgical incision required continued monitoring for signs of infection, separation, or other complications.
  • Poor appetite and weight loss: Her nutritional intake was still below what her body needed for recovery. She required encouragement, monitoring, and structured meal support.
  • Digestive changes: Pancreatic surgery alters how the body processes food. She needed observation for digestive symptoms, stool changes, and food tolerance issues.
  • General weakness: Combined with her pre-existing anemia and the physical stress of surgery, her energy levels were significantly reduced.
  • Blood glucose variability: With diabetes and a surgically altered pancreas, her blood sugar needed closer monitoring than it did before surgery.
  • Mobility limitation: Her osteoarthritis compounded the deconditioning from hospitalization, making rehabilitation more complex.
Why Not Just Family Care?

Harleen’s family was willing and capable of providing emotional support and basic assistance. However, the Whipple procedure creates specific clinical risks that require trained observation. Wound deterioration, delayed gastric emptying, pancreatic fistula, blood glucose crises, and nutritional failure can develop gradually and may not be recognized early by family members alone. Professional home nursing provides the clinical layer that family care alone cannot fully replace during this high-risk recovery window.

Wound Care

The abdominal incision from a Whipple procedure is significant in length. Proper wound management at home was essential to prevent surgical site infection, which is one of the more common complications after major abdominal surgery.

The wound was managed according to the surgeon’s specific instructions. The family was advised to:

  • Keep the wound clean and dry as instructed by the surgical team
  • Avoid unnecessary touching or manipulation of the incision area
  • Follow dressing change instructions precisely
  • Watch for increasing redness, swelling, or new drainage
  • Report any wound separation immediately
  • Avoid applying unapproved creams, oils, or home remedies to the wound

This approach to wound care and infection prevention follows established postoperative principles. Surgical wound infections often develop between the fifth and tenth day after surgery, which means the home care period is precisely when vigilance matters most.

Medication Management

After a Whipple procedure, patients are typically prescribed multiple medications. Harleen’s regimen included pain management, diabetes medications, pancreatic enzyme replacement if prescribed, and medications to support digestion or prevent complications.

The home team supported medication management by ensuring that medications were taken correctly, on schedule, and that any side effects or concerns were documented and communicated to the doctor.

Important Note on Diabetes Medication

The family was specifically advised not to independently change diabetes medication doses. Pancreatic surgery can significantly alter glucose regulation. What worked before surgery may not be appropriate after. Any adjustment to diabetes medication needed to be directed by the treating doctor based on documented blood glucose patterns.

Nutritional Support

Nutrition was arguably the most challenging aspect of Harleen’s recovery. The Whipple procedure fundamentally changes how the digestive system processes food. Patients often experience early fullness, reduced appetite, nausea, and changes in how nutrients are absorbed.

The nutritional approach included:

  • Following the specific diet plan prepared by her medical and nutrition team
  • Small, frequent meals rather than three large meals
  • Monitoring daily food intake and comparing it with recommended targets
  • Tracking weight to identify concerning trends
  • Ensuring adequate hydration between meals
  • Monitoring blood glucose in relation to meals
  • Watching for signs of nutritional deficiency

The family was counselled not to impose additional dietary restrictions beyond what the medical team had recommended. Some families mistakenly remove foods from the patient’s diet thinking they are helping, when in fact the patient is already eating very little and needs every appropriate calorie they can tolerate. The role of nutrition in recovery cannot be overstated after major pancreatic surgery.

Risks Being Monitored

The home healthcare team maintained ongoing vigilance for a range of postoperative complications. The Whipple procedure carries specific risks that extend well beyond the immediate postoperative period.

RiskWhy It MattersMonitoring Approach
Surgical-site infectionLarge abdominal incision with multiple reconnectionsDaily wound inspection for redness, swelling, drainage, warmth, fever
Wound separationCan occur due to poor nutrition, coughing, or tensionVisual inspection of incision integrity at each visit
Postoperative bleedingInternal bleeding can develop graduallyMonitoring for dropping blood pressure, increasing heart rate, pallor, weakness
Pancreatic/ digestive complicationsIncludes pancreatic fistula, anastomotic leakWatching for abdominal pain, fever, drainage changes, increasing nausea
Delayed gastric emptyingCommon after Whipple surgeryMonitoring for persistent nausea, vomiting, early fullness
Poor nutritional intakeCan delay wound healing and overall recoveryDaily food intake documentation, weekly weight checks
DehydrationPoor oral intake combined with surgical fluid shiftsMonitoring oral fluid intake, skin turgor, urine output, dizziness
Blood glucose instabilityAltered pancreatic function after surgeryRegular glucometer readings, pattern analysis by doctor
Blood clots (DVT/PE)Reduced mobility after major surgery increases riskLeg swelling or pain assessment, encouraging mobilization, breathing observation
Significant weight lossIndicates nutritional failureWeekly weight measurement with trend analysis
Warning Signs Requiring Immediate Medical Attention

The family was instructed to seek prompt medical attention if any of the following occurred:

  • Persistent vomiting that prevented keeping fluids down
  • Severe or increasing abdominal pain
  • Fever (temperature above normal range)
  • New or increasing wound drainage
  • Wound separation or opening
  • Black or bloody stools
  • Severe weakness or inability to stand
  • Inability to maintain fluid intake
  • Significant blood glucose abnormalities (very high or very low)
  • Sudden breathlessness or chest pain

These warning signs were clearly communicated and reinforced during every nursing visit. Understanding why patients can deteriorate suddenly at home helps families appreciate the importance of rapid response.

Key Clinical Learnings

1. Extended Rehabilitation Is Expected

Recovery from a pancreaticoduodenectomy involves several weeks or months of gradual rehabilitation. Families should be counselled before discharge that the hospital stay is only the beginning. Setting realistic expectations prevents disappointment and helps families stay engaged with the recovery process over time.

2. Nutrition Is Central to Recovery

Poor appetite, early fullness, weight loss, and digestive changes should be monitored closely after Whipple surgery. Nutritional failure can delay wound healing, reduce strength, and increase susceptibility to complications. A structured nutritional plan guided by the surgical and nutrition team is more effective than family-imposed dietary restrictions.

3. Enzyme Replacement May Be Needed

Some patients have reduced pancreatic digestive enzyme production after surgery. Enzyme replacement can improve digestion and nutrient absorption. However, it should be prescribed and adjusted by the treating medical team based on the patient’s symptoms and nutritional needs, not started or changed based on general advice.

4. Blood Glucose Patterns Change

Patients with pre-existing diabetes may require closer monitoring and medication review after pancreatic surgery. The portion of the pancreas that remains may produce less insulin than before. Regular glucose monitoring with documented readings allows the treating doctor to make informed adjustments.

5. Wound Monitoring After Discharge

Surgical site infections often develop after the patient has left the hospital. Redness, drainage, fever, wound separation, or increasing pain should prompt medical assessment. Families trained to recognize these signs can seek help earlier, potentially preventing more serious complications. This is a core principle of effective infection prevention after surgery.

6. Gradual Mobility Reduces Deconditioning

Walking and strengthening should progress according to postoperative restrictions. Starting with seated exercises and short supervised walks, then gradually increasing distance and intensity, allows the body to rebuild strength without stressing the surgical site.

7. Small, Frequent Meals Improve Tolerance

The reconstructed digestive system after a Whipple procedure often handles smaller meals better than larger ones. Individual dietary plans should be guided by the patient’s surgical and nutrition team rather than generalized advice from non-medical sources.

Frequently Asked Questions

What is Whipple surgery?+
The Whipple procedure, or pancreaticoduodenectomy, is a major operation commonly performed for selected diseases involving the head of the pancreas and nearby structures. It may involve removal of the head of the pancreas, the duodenum, the gallbladder, part of the bile duct, and sometimes part of the stomach. The remaining organs are then surgically reconnected to restore digestive continuity.
How long does recovery after Whipple surgery take?+
Recovery varies considerably between individuals. Some people regain basic independence within several weeks, while nutritional recovery, strength restoration, and adjustment to digestive changes may take several months. Full recovery can extend well beyond three months. The timeline depends on the patient’s overall health, the specifics of the surgery, and the support available during recovery.
Why are small meals sometimes recommended after surgery?+
The digestive system needs time to adapt after major pancreatic surgery. The stomach may empty more slowly, and the remaining digestive structures may not handle large volumes of food well initially. Smaller, more frequent meals may be easier for some patients to tolerate. However, the exact nutritional plan should always come from the treating surgical and nutrition team.
Can pancreatic surgery affect blood sugar?+
Yes. The pancreas produces insulin, which regulates blood glucose. When a portion of the pancreas is removed, insulin production can be affected. People who already have diabetes may therefore need closer monitoring and possible medication adjustment after surgery. Even patients without prior diabetes can develop blood sugar abnormalities after pancreatic surgery.
Why might pancreatic enzymes be prescribed?+
The pancreas produces enzymes that help break down fats, proteins, and carbohydrates in food. After surgical removal of part of the pancreas, enzyme production may be reduced. This can lead to poor digestion, greasy stools, weight loss, and nutritional deficiency. Pancreatic enzyme replacement therapy, when prescribed by the medical team, can help restore normal digestion.
When should a caregiver worry about the surgical wound?+
Increasing redness that spreads beyond the immediate wound edges, new swelling, any drainage or discharge from the wound, wound separation or opening, worsening pain at the incision site, or fever should all be reported to the surgical team promptly. These may indicate a surgical site infection or other wound complication that requires medical assessment.
Can physiotherapy start after Whipple surgery?+
Yes. Appropriate mobility and rehabilitation often begin during the hospital stay itself, with gentle movement and early walking. After discharge, physiotherapy continues at home with exercises that are adjusted to the patient’s surgical restrictions and recovery level. The physiotherapist works within the boundaries set by the surgical team to ensure that exercise supports recovery without risking harm to the surgical site.
Does home care replace surgical follow-up?+
No. Home healthcare supports recovery between hospital discharge and specialist visits, but it does not replace regular surgical, gastroenterology, nutrition, or other specialist follow-up. Patients should attend all recommended outpatient appointments and investigations. Home care and hospital-based care work together as complementary parts of the recovery process.
What digestive changes are common after Whipple surgery?+
Common digestive changes include early fullness after eating, reduced appetite, nausea, changes in bowel habits, and in some cases greasy or bulky stools. These occur because the surgery alters the normal anatomy of digestion. Many of these changes improve over weeks to months as the body adapts. However, persistent or worsening digestive symptoms should be discussed with the medical team, as they may indicate a need for enzyme replacement or other interventions.
